    Daily Visual Checks

    Operators should begin each shift with a thorough visual inspection of the pistachio sorter. They look for signs of wear, misalignment, or buildup of debris. Common issues often include contamination from rocks, metals, and other foreign bodies. These contaminants can damage sensitive equipment and cause unexpected shutdowns. Facilities like Setton Pistachio have faced costly repairs due to such problems. Regular checks help identify these hazards early and prevent equipment failure.

    Sensor and Illumination Calibration

    Sensors and lighting systems play a crucial role in the accuracy of a pistachio sorter. Technicians must calibrate these components regularly to maintain high sorting precision. Incorrect calibration can lead to poor product quality or missed contaminants. Many commercial facilities now use advanced X-ray inspection technology. This technology detects foreign objects that traditional sensors might miss, reducing the risk of equipment damage.

    Environmental Monitoring

    Environmental factors such as temperature, humidity, and dust levels can affect the performance of a pistachio sorter. Staff should monitor these conditions throughout the day. High humidity or excessive dust may interfere with sensors and moving parts. Installing environmental sensors and maintaining proper ventilation helps keep the sorter running smoothly. Consistent monitoring ensures the equipment operates within optimal parameters.

    Scheduled Cleaning Procedures

    Regular cleaning routines keep the pistachio sorter operating at peak efficiency. Operators should follow a strict schedule, cleaning all contact surfaces, chutes, and sorting trays at the end of each shift. They should also remove debris from hard-to-reach areas. A detailed cleaning log helps track completed tasks and ensures accountability. Many facilities use a checklist to verify that no area is missed. This approach reduces the risk of residue buildup and mechanical failure.

    Safe Handling of Cleaning Agents

    Staff must use cleaning agents that are food-safe and approved for use in food processing environments. They should always wear protective gloves and eyewear when handling chemicals. Proper dilution and application prevent damage to sensitive components. Operators should rinse all surfaces thoroughly to remove any chemical residue. Training sessions help staff understand the correct procedures and the importance of safety during cleaning.

    Preventing Contamination

    Effective contamination control starts with the right equipment and methods. The water flotation tank removes over half of aflatoxin contamination, while air flotation systems contribute only a small percentage. Facilities that use a rubber-drum huller instead of a metal-drum type see better sorting results. These steps, combined with regular cleaning, greatly reduce the risk of contamination in the pistachio sorter. Operators should inspect equipment after each cleaning to confirm that no foreign material remains.

    Air Valve and Belt Inspection

    Operators must inspect air valves and belts regularly to maintain consistent performance. Air valves control the flow of compressed air, which is essential for accurate sorting. Worn or leaking valves can cause misdirected airflow, leading to sorting errors. Belts transport pistachios through the machine. Frayed or misaligned belts may result in jams or uneven product flow. Technicians should check for visible wear, tension, and alignment during each maintenance cycle. Early detection of issues prevents unexpected downtime and extends equipment life.

    Managing Spare Parts Inventory

    A well-organized spare parts inventory supports rapid repairs and minimizes downtime. Facilities should track critical components such as belts, air valves, and nozzles. Using inventory management software helps staff monitor stock levels and reorder parts before shortages occur. Quick access to replacement parts ensures the pistachio sorter returns to operation without delay. Staff should review inventory records regularly and update them after each maintenance activity.

    Operator Training Programs

    Effective operator training programs form the backbone of reliable pistachio sorting operations. Facilities invest in structured onboarding sessions for new staff. These sessions cover machine operation, safety protocols, and troubleshooting techniques. Experienced operators often lead hands-on demonstrations. They show new team members how to identify common issues and perform basic maintenance. Regular refresher courses keep everyone updated on the latest technology and best practices.

    Maintenance Documentation

    Accurate maintenance documentation ensures consistency and accountability. Staff record every inspection, repair, and cleaning activity in detailed logs. These records help managers track recurring issues and schedule preventive maintenance. Many facilities use digital platforms to store and organize documentation. This approach allows quick access to maintenance history and supports compliance with food safety standards.

    FAQ

    How often should operators calibrate pistachio sorter sensors?

    Operators should calibrate sensors weekly. Frequent calibration ensures accurate sorting and prevents product quality issues.

    What cleaning agents work best for pistachio sorters?

    Food-grade, non-corrosive cleaning agents work best. These agents protect sensitive components and maintain food safety standards.
